The Import function can help you bring data from other software to the online program. Let me share some information on what you can and cannot bring into QuickBooks.
Before importing your invoices, prepare first your spreadsheet and make sure to fill in the following columns:
In case the invoices have multiple line items, make sure each line entry has an invoice number, customer, invoice date, etc. just like in the sample spreadsheet. If you collect taxes, add the tax rate to your invoices in the spreadsheet. When importing, map the tax codes you created into QuickBooks tax codes.
Also, map each of your column headings to the invoice fields during the import. Click here to view our sample file. Then continue performing Steps 2 up to 5 in this article: Import multiple invoices at once.
For your bills, and bank reconciliations, import them via CSV file. While you'll have to use a spreadsheet to bring your products and services.
